The station ensures a seamless experience with a comprehensive array of facilities. Whether buying a ticket or picking up one pre-purchased online, passengers can utilize the ticket machines which are accessible for all, including those with disabilities. The station also offers smartcards for a modern touch to your travel needs. For any assistance, staff help is widely available through help points, information screens, and the dedicated Customer Service Centre, ensuring that a helpful hand is never far away. Additionally, there's step-free access throughout the station, including long ramps for ease of movement.
Bournemouth Train Station might lack a traditional waiting room, but there's ample seating available for travelers awaiting departure. While it does not offer lounge services, refreshments can be found on Platforms 2 and 3, including a Starbucks. Best not to rely on finding ATMs or shops here, however. For those needing to stay connected, complimentary public Wi-Fi is available, with helpful links to hotspots around the station.
Travelers will benefit from the station's excellent transport connectivity. For those moving onward by car, there are 362 parking spaces available and specially marked bays for Blue Badge holders. If you arrive by bike, there are 118 spaces with sheltered cycle storage under CCTV. For public transportation users, buses and taxis provide seamless travel to further destinations. The airport is easily accessible via Morebus service 737, while the station is a pivotal access point for rail replacement services reaching Southampton and Poole.

At Brough Station, you will find a range of facilities designed for traveler convenience. The ticket office is open most days from 5:15 AM to 7:45 PM, with slightly reduced hours on Sundays, ensuring ample opportunities for ticket purchases and inquiries. For those purchasing tickets online, ticket machines enable easy collection. Moreover, the station is equipped with an induction loop, enhancing the experience for those requiring hearing support.
Accessibility is prioritized at Brough Station. With step-free access, passengers can move effortlessly throughout the station, and boarding ramps are readily available. While heated waiting rooms provide comfort on cooler days, there is no on-site luggage storage or accessible toilets - a consideration for planning your trip.
Travellers looking to park their vehicles benefit from a car park open 24/7 operated by APCOA with services on behalf of TransPennine Express. With 172 total parking spaces, including six accessible ones, it ensures ample room for those driving in for their journey.
Once you've arrived at Brough Train Station, various onward travel options make your journey even smoother. For quick rides, taxis are available right from the station platform. If you're faced with service disruptions, rail replacement coaches conveniently depart just outside the nearby Ferry Inn on Station Road. Buses also offer a viable option, with comprehensive information readily available in a printable format to help plan your journey seamlessly.
